I'm unable to get haptic connect to activate via DeoVR on a Quest 3. Had same issue with Quest 2. Any help appreciated.

I click the toggle in settings, it goes blue (but is just list as Haptics Connect, there is no SLR Interactive on the toggle as I've seen in some setup guides), but going back to the home screen shows Haptic Connect as red/disconnected, and in fact scripts don't work. What am I missing to connected a Lovense device? I have a script acct.

    Hey desklamp3, try following these exact steps below as those proved to resolve the issue that you are currently facing:

    • Disable the haptics toggle in DeoVR.
    • Log out of your SLR account in DeoVR and close the app.
    • Close the Haptics Connect app.
    • Go to your phone app settings and delete the Haptics Connect app cache.
    • Disconnect your toy from any other haptic app you might have used recently.
    • Unpair the toy from your phone, turn off the toy, and disable Bluetooth on your phone.
    • Enable Bluetooth on your phone again, pair your toy with your phone, and turn the toy off again.
    • Run the Haptics Connect app, open a browser on your phone, go to the SLR website, and log in.
    • If you are still logged in to SLR with your browser log out, and log in again.
    • Go to your SLR profile page and click the connect to Haptics button.
    • Turn on the toy and make sure your toy is found and connected in the Haptics Connect app.
    • Launch DeoVR after your toy is successfully connected to the Haptics Connect app.
    • Log back in to your SLR account with DeoVR, and re-enable haptics in DeoVR.

    Please note that it's important to follow the instructions in the correct order to ensure a successful connection.
